Questions to Ask Before Hiring

  • For Ridout: Ask about their experience with your specific roofing material and whether they've handled homes of your age and architectural style
  • For Eagle Air: Ask whether your HVAC equipment brand is one they service regularly and what their typical response time is for your location
  • For either: Confirm their current crew's experience level and how long key team members have been with the company
  • For either: Ask for references from recent projects similar in scope to yours

Not all licensed contractors are created equal. While a valid license is the baseline requirement in California, contractors can vary significantly in experience, insurance coverage, and customer satisfaction.

  • Experience matters: A contractor with 15+ years of experience has likely encountered and solved problems that newer contractors haven't faced yet.
  • Workers' compensation protects you: If a contractor without workers' comp insurance has an employee injured on your property, you could be held liable.
  • Reviews reveal patterns: Individual reviews can be misleading, but patterns across many reviews often reveal a contractor's true strengths and weaknesses.
  • Bond amounts vary: A contractor's bond provides financial protection if they fail to complete work as agreed. Higher bonds offer more protection.

Taking time to compare contractors on these factors can save you from costly mistakes and help ensure your project is completed by a qualified professional.
